Handing off the Brindlewood pool work before the sync. Bumped max connections on the Saxifrage replica to stop the checkout stalls; idle timeout still needs tuning, see my notes in the pooling doc. One gotcha: the metrics exporter reuses a pooled connection, so restarts look scary but aren't. The staging dashboard unlocks with the passphrase just below.

vault phrase of bagaf-kajeg = jorath-feniel-briir-siliel-ralix

## Local setup: config hot-reload

Quick notes for the sync: Brindlecast now watches `conf.d/` and reloads on change — no restart needed. Run `brindle dev --watch` and edit any TOML file; changes land in ~2s. Gotcha: renaming a file counts as delete+create, so defaults briefly apply. Reload events get journaled to the local dev database so we can replay config drift. Point your watcher at it using the connection string below.

replica DSN, tadup-fahif: clickhouse://fraiel_svc:OXtAM8cj4MFYZH@db-ce5e.braskdata.example:5432/fraeth

## Service Accounts — TaxGrid Lookup Cache

The rate-cache warmer runs under the svc-taxgrid account. Support may query the cache read-only; never invalidate entries manually. Rotation happens monthly, automated. If a customer reports stale rates, check the warmer's last run first. Read-only access authenticates with the key below.

gateway credential: kto3_qfe

**Ticket LIFT-442: Dispatch simulator ignores plugin-registered express zones.** In Towerline Sim, plugins that register express zones via the hooks API see their zones silently dropped when more than six cars are simulated. Standard zones work fine. Reproduced on the Merrowgate sample building with the stock demo plugin. Plugin authors should pin to the previous minor release until a patch lands. The failing run can be identified by the trace token below.

pipeline stamp: htk21_86b657ac0aa916a9af17f

Fan-out backpressure for the Quillet notifier: when the queue depth crosses the soft limit, the dispatcher sheds low-priority pushes and batches the rest at 500ms intervals. Reviewer should confirm the shed counter is exported and that retries respect the jitter window. Once merged, the release artifact gets re-signed by the pipeline, which expects the deploy key shown below.

deploy key for bawep-yawif: bky6_GQhaSt